<u>Statement</u><u>:</u>
A person is running at an initial velocity of 3.7 m/s. If the person is accelerating at 2 m/s².
<u>To </u><u>find </u><u>out:</u>
The person's final velocity after 3 s.
<u>Solution</u><u>:</u>
- Initial velocity (u) = 3.7 m/s
- Acceleration (a) = 2 m/s²
- Time taken (t) = 3 s
- We know, the equation of motion,
- v = u + at
- Putting the values in the above equation, we get,
- v = 3.7 m/s + 2 m/s² × 3 s
- or, v = 3.7 m/s + 6 m/s
- or, v = 9.7 m/s
<u>Answer</u><u>:</u>
The final velocity is 9.7 m/s in the direction of the motion.
